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read

When I first created this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read, I was amazed at how easy it was to make such a delicious and healthy treat.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read quickly became a staple in my kitchen. The blend of almond flour, fresh garlic, and a mix of herbs creates a spread that’s both creamy and flavorful. Whether you’re slathering it on a bagel or using it as a dip, this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read never fails to impress.

Creating the Perfect Blend

In making the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read, I start with a simple liquid base: water and fresh lemon juice, combined with almond flour and nutritional yeast for a cheesy flavor. Blending these ingredients gives the spread its smooth texture. The real magic happens when I add in the garlic and a mix of dried herbs—oregano, parsley, thyme, dill, and basil. Each herb adds its unique touch, making the spread aromatic and savory.

Letting It Chill

After blending everything together, I let the spread chill in the refrigerator for about an hour. This resting period allows the flavors to meld and the spread to firm up. Once it’s ready, the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read is perfect for serving with crackers or veggies. Sometimes, I even roll it into a ball and coat it with chopped nuts or fresh herbs for a festive touch.

Chef’s Notes-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read

  • Blending Tips: To achieve a perfectly smooth and creamy texture, make sure your food processor or blender is high-speed. If the mixture is too thick or dry, add a tablespoon of water at a time, but be careful not to overdo it to prevent the spread from becoming too runny.
  • Flavor Adjustments: Feel free to adjust the amount of garlic and herbs based on your taste preferences. If you prefer a more robust garlic flavor, you can add an extra clove. For a milder taste, reduce the garlic or use roasted garlic.
  • Consistency: If you like your spread firmer, let it set in the refrigerator for the full 1-2 hours. For a softer, more dip-like consistency, you can use the spread immediately after blending.
  • Alternative Ingredients: If you have nut allergies, cashew flour or sunflower seed flour are excellent substitutes for almond flour. Lime juice or white vinegar can replace lemon juice, and grated vegan parmesan can be used instead of nutritional yeast.
  • Serving Suggestions: This spread can be used not just as a topping but also as a creamy base for pasta dishes or as a dip for chips. For a festive touch, consider rolling the spread into a ball and coating it with chopped nuts or fresh herbs.

Ingredients

  • Liquid Base
  • 1/2 cup water

  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ice or apple cider vinegar

  • Dry Ingredients
  • 1 1/2 cups finely ground almond flour

  • 1 tablespoon nutritional yeast flakes

  • Flavor Enhancers
  • 2 cloves fresh garlic

  • 1 tablespoon dried oregano leaves

  • 2 teaspoons dried parsley flakes

  • 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me leaves

  • 1/2 teaspoon dried dill weed

  • 1/2 teaspoon dried basil leaves

  • Salt to taste

Directions

  • Blending the Base – In a high-speed blender or food processor, combine the water, lemon juice, garlic cloves, and almond flour. Blend until the mixture is smooth and creamy. This should take about 2-3 minutes. If needed, add a tablespoon of water at a time to assist blending but avoid making the mixture too runny.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read_ post 1
  • Mixing in Flavors – Transfer the blended mixture to a mixing bowl. Add the nutritional yeast and all the dried herbs (oregano, parsley, thyme, dill, basil). Stir thoroughly until everything is well incorporated. Taste and adjust salt as needed.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read_ post 2
  • Setting the Spread – Spoon the mixture into your desired container, ensuring it is packed tightly to avoid air pockets. Place it in the refrigerator and let it set for 1-2 hours if you prefer a firmer consistency.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read_ post 3
  • Serving Suggestions – Once set, serve the spread with fresh veggies, crackers, bagels, or use it as a sandwich spread.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read_ post 4

FAQs-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read

Can I make this spread 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are the spread up to 3 days in advance. Store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It will stay fresh and flavorful, and the flavors may even intensify over time.

How long does this spread last in the fridge?

The Garlic Herb Vegan Cheese Spread will last for about 5-7 days in the refrigerator when stored in an airtight container.

Can I freeze this spread?

Freezing is not recommended as it may affect the texture of the spread. It’s best enjoyed fresh or refrigerated.

Can I use fresh herbs instead of dried ones?

Yes, you can use fresh herbs, but you’ll need to increase the quantity as fresh herbs are less concentrated. Use about 3 tablespoons of fresh herbs for each tablespoon of dried herbs.

What can I do if the spread is too thick?

If the spread turns out too thick, you can add a bit more water or lemon juice to reach your desired consistency. Blend it again until smooth.
